Renee Keeble, CEO of SA Commercial, a company that employs 180 staff members and operates from both Johannesburg and Cape Town, says she was born with an entrepreneurial spirit, having always dreamt of running her own business.
I grew up in Cape Town. My Dad was a very successful sales person and my Mom spent many years in Education. They both eventually moved into entrepreneurship, running a few businesses. I worked in my parent’s business from a young age and learned some of the essential skills needed to run a successful business.
After receiving my IMM (International Marketing Management), I began my career with one of the largest South African financial services companies where I received the highest level of training and finally moved into divisional management, managing the profitability of the direct marketing division. This is where I fell in love with the industry and just knew it would be a stepping stone towards my own business.
Thus in 2007, with support from my husband, Wayne Keeble, who is also my business partner, I decided to start up SA Commercial. Wayne had already started SA Commercial Short-Term Insurance and it made business sense to use the current infrastructure and business credentials to bolt on SA Commercial BPO. It was exciting and fearful times when I left a permanent job to start my business! The first year was tough and I never realized until then, that decision making would play such a key role in sustaining a business. Knowing when to base your decision on facts or use your intuition or both, becomes a critical influence when trusting your conclusion. That sounds quite easy – right! But when you are affecting the livelihood of more than 180 people, it is no longer about you – it’s about the people in your business and the decision becomes 100% more important and personal to you. So, the second toughest part of being an entrepreneur is consistently displaying a positive approach and to remember to fail quick and cheap.
